#1 .com Domain: The Undisputed King of the Internet
The .com domain isn’t just the most registered domain globally; it consistently holds the top spot at 101domain, year after year. Launched in 1985 primarily for “commercial” entities, .com has transcended its original intent to become synonymous with the internet itself. With over 150 million registrations, its sheer ubiquity offers an immediate sense of trust and familiarity to users worldwide. When people think of a website, they instinctively append “.com” to its name. This inherent recognition is a tremendous asset for any business, offering unparalleled credibility and brand recall. However, its immense popularity also presents a significant challenge: finding short, memorable, and relevant .com domain names that are still available can be incredibly difficult due to years of extensive registration. Despite this, the .com domain remains the gold standard for businesses, startups, and personal brands aiming for a universal online presence.

#2 .ai Domain: The Future of Innovation
The .ai domain has experienced a meteoric rise, securing its position as the second most popular extension at 101domain. While officially the country-code top-level domain (ccTLD) for Anguilla, a small Caribbean island, its short and impactful nature has led to its widespread adoption by the artificial intelligence industry. It wasn’t until around 2016 that the tech community began to repurpose .ai for AI-related ventures, catapulting it into the spotlight. This domain extension has become the de facto choice for startups, researchers, and companies innovating in AI, machine learning, and robotics. Its appeal lies in its direct relevance to the booming AI sector, offering immediate brand recognition and an impression of forward-thinking. Crucially, the .ai domain market is still relatively nascent compared to .com, meaning there are plentiful opportunities to acquire unique and meaningful domain names without the premium pricing often associated with highly sought-after extensions. This makes .ai an excellent choice for anyone looking to establish a credible and cutting-edge presence in the AI space.

#3 .net Domain: The Reliable Network
The .net domain stands as another venerable top-level domain, sharing its legacy with .com under the same registry, Verisign. Originally intended for organizations involved in network technologies, .net has evolved into a versatile and trusted alternative. It’s often the go-to option when your preferred .com name is unavailable, providing a strong, recognizable, and professional online address. Many businesses consider owning their brand name across both .com and .net as a crucial strategy for brand protection. This proactive measure prevents competitors or “cybersquatters” from registering a similar name under .net and potentially confusing your customer base or even launching fraudulent sites. The .net domain is celebrated for its global recognition, affordability, and the absence of restrictive registration requirements, making it an accessible and popular choice for a wide array of websites, from tech companies to general businesses seeking a robust online presence.

#4 .org Domain: The Pillar of Organizations
The .org domain is a classic and enduring TLD that consistently ranks high in domain registrations. From its inception, .org was designated for “organizations,” quickly becoming the quintessential choice for non-profits, charities, educational institutions, community groups, and open-source projects. Its association with non-commercial entities has imbued it with a strong sense of trustworthiness and public service. When users encounter a .org website, they generally expect authoritative, unbiased, and community-focused content, fostering a unique level of credibility. Despite its reputable image, the .org domain boasts a low barrier to entry and no specific registration restrictions, making it widely accessible. This combination of widespread trust and ease of registration ensures that .org remains a top contender for any organization seeking to establish a reliable and respected online footprint.

#5 .app Domain: The Digital Application Hub
The .app domain, backed by Google, is a modern TLD specifically designed for applications, mobile apps, and developers. As with many Google initiatives, like Google Workspace, quality and functionality are paramount. The .app extension helps applications stand out and get discovered in a crowded digital marketplace. A key distinguishing feature of all Google-managed domains is their built-in security: they mandate the use of SSL certificates, ensuring encrypted connections and a safer experience for users. This security-first approach makes .app domains highly desirable for any entity handling user data or offering downloads. Since its launch in 2018, the .app domain has enjoyed remarkable growth, boasting over 700,000 registrations and continually climbing. It’s the perfect choice for showcasing your app, building a development portfolio, or creating a secure online platform.

#6 .ae Domain: Gateway to the Emirates
The .ae domain serves as the official country-code top-level domain for the United Arab Emirates. This dynamic and rapidly growing economic hub makes .ae a highly attractive option for businesses and individuals looking to establish a strong presence in the Middle East. One of the primary reasons for its popularity at 101domain is its accessible registration policy: there are no residency requirements, meaning anyone, anywhere in the world, can register a .ae domain. This open policy has significantly broadened its appeal beyond the UAE borders, allowing international businesses to easily tap into the lucrative Emirati market. With over 150,000 registrations, .ae offers a credible and localized identity, signaling commitment to the region. For companies targeting customers in Dubai, Abu Dhabi, and beyond, a .ae domain is an essential step towards building trust and relevance in this thriving market.

#7 .aero Domain: Soaring with Aviation Professionals
The .aero domain is a truly specialized TLD, unique in its creation for a single industrial sector: aviation. This exclusivity makes .aero an invaluable asset for companies, organizations, and individuals operating within the aerospace community. Unlike many open TLDs, .aero maintains strict eligibility criteria to ensure that all registered names genuinely belong to verified members of the aviation industry. To register a .aero domain, applicants must first apply for a SITA-aero ID. This rigorous verification process involves submitting documentation such as company documents, pilot licenses, or relevant association memberships. This stringent gatekeeping guarantees the integrity and legitimacy of all content found under the .aero extension, fostering a highly trusted and professional environment. For anyone in aviation, from airlines and manufacturers to pilots and enthusiasts, a .aero domain instantly conveys industry affiliation and credibility.

#8 .co.uk Domain: Britain’s Trusted Online Address
The .co.uk domain serves as the most popular second-level domain under the .uk country-code TLD. For many years, .uk itself was not directly available for registration, making .co.uk the de facto choice for British businesses and individuals. Its “co” prefix quickly became associated with “commercial” and offered a familiar ring, akin to .com, which cemented its status as the premier online identity within the United Kingdom. Although the direct .uk domain opened for general registration in 2019, .co.uk retains a strong hold due to its established recognition and legacy. With Brexit leading to the UK’s departure from the European Union, we anticipate a continued, and perhaps even increased, migration of online presences to national ccTLDs like .co.uk. Many entities that previously relied on the .eu domain are now securing their local identity with .co.uk, ensuring a clear and direct connection to the UK market.

#9 .in Domain: India’s Digital Footprint
The .in domain is the official country-code top-level domain for India. Given India’s enormous population and its rapidly expanding digital economy, it’s no surprise that .in ranks among our most popular ccTLDs. India is renowned for its vibrant entrepreneurial spirit and a highly tech-savvy populace, making .in an essential domain for businesses, startups, and individuals targeting this immense market. Both companies and individuals can register a .in domain, and importantly, there are no residency requirements, making it accessible to a global audience. This open policy allows international entities to establish a strong, localized presence in one of the world’s most significant growth markets without geographical restrictions. With over 2.3 million domain names registered, .in is consistently one of the top 25 most registered TLDs on the internet, reflecting its critical importance for anyone looking to connect with the Indian online community.

#10 .ru Domain: Russia’s Digital Frontier
Rounding out our top 10 is the .ru domain, the official country-code top-level domain for Russia. This TLD is widely used by both companies and individuals seeking to establish an online presence within the Russian Federation. While registration is open, there are specific requirements that must be met, often involving the submission of identification or business documents, reflecting a more regulated environment. With over 4.8 million domain name registrations, .ru is one of the top 10 most registered domain extensions globally, underscoring its immense importance in the Russian digital landscape. However, it’s also recognized as one of the most susceptible TLDs to cybersquatting and domain disputes. This unique characteristic makes .ru a critical domain for brand protection strategies. Businesses with intellectual property or a strong brand presence should consider defensively registering their names in .ru, especially since Russia does not have a standardized Uniform Domain-Name Dispute-Resolution Policy (UDRP) process for trademark infringement, making proactive registration even more vital.

Strategies for Building a Robust Domain Portfolio with Popular Extensions
While one primary domain name will serve as your website’s main address, a strategic approach involves building a comprehensive domain portfolio. This practice extends beyond simply securing your core brand name; it’s a vital component of a holistic digital strategy, offering numerous benefits for your online presence, marketing efforts, and brand protection.
One of the key reasons to acquire multiple domain extensions is to simplify user access. You can register various relevant domain names and easily set up web forwarding. This redirects visitors from alternative URLs directly to your main website, ensuring that even if they type in a slightly different extension or variation, they still reach your intended destination. This enhances user experience and minimizes lost traffic.

Beyond convenience, a domain portfolio is an indispensable tool for safeguarding your brand from malicious actors. Registering common misspellings, plural forms, or your brand name across various popular TLDs prevents “cybersquatters” and opportunistic competitors from acquiring these names. Such defensive registrations thwart attempts to profit from your brand’s reputation, confuse your customers, or divert your hard-earned traffic. In today’s highly competitive digital age, a well-managed domain portfolio is also an effective advertising tool. Owning short, relevant, and memorable domain names across different extensions strengthens your brand’s visibility and recall, making it easier for potential customers to find and engage with your business. By thoughtfully curating a selection of domain names, you build a resilient and expansive online presence that protects your assets and amplifies your reach.
